Stanford’s mobile ALOHA robot learns from humans to cook, clean, do laundry.

A new AI system developed by researchers at Stanford University makes impressive breakthroughs in training mobile robots that can perform complex tasks in different environments. 

Called Mobile ALOHA (A Low-cost Open-source Hardware System for Bimanual Teleoperation) the system addresses the high costs and technical challenges of training mobile bimanual robots that require careful guidance from human operators. 

It costs a fraction of off-the-shelf systems and can learn from as few as 50 human demonstrations. 

This new system comes against the backdrop of an acceleration in robotics, enabled partly by the success of generative models.

Limits of current robotics systems

Most robotic manipulation tasks focus on table-top manipulation. This includes a recent wave of models that have been built based on transformers and diffusion models, architectures widely used in generative AI.

However, many of these models lack the mobility and dexterity necessary for generally useful tasks. Many tasks in everyday environments require coordinating mobility and dexterous manipulation capabilities.

Mobile ALOHA

The new system developed by Stanford researchers builds on top of ALOHA, a low-cost and whole-body teleoperation system for collecting bimanual mobile manipulation data.

A human operator demonstrates tasks by manipulating the robot arms through a teleoperated control. The system captures the demonstration data and uses it to train a control system through end-to-end imitation learning.

Mobile ALOHA extends the system by mounting it on a wheeled base. It is designed to provide a cost-effective solution for training robotic systems. The entire setup, which includes webcams and a laptop with a consumer-grade GPU, costs around $32,000, which is much cheaper than off-the-shelf bimanual robots, which can cost up to $200,000.

Mobile ALOHA configuration (source: arxiv)

Mobile ALOHA is designed to teleoperate all degrees of freedom simultaneously. The human operator is tethered to the system by the waist and drives it around the work environment while operating the arms with controllers. This enables the robot control system to simultaneously learn movement and other control commands. Once it gathers enough information, the model can then repeat the sequence of tasks autonomously.

5 Ways Technology Empowers Female Entrepreneurs…!

Technology has opened up countless opportunities for women entrepreneurs. Here are 5 key ways that technology empowers women in business:

  1. Enables new business models – The internet and mobile technology have enabled new business models like social commerce, digital products, affiliate marketing, and the creator/influencer economy. Women leverage these models to start and grow businesses on their own terms.

2. Provides flexibility – With a laptop and internet connection, women can run their businesses from anywhere, on their own schedules. This is especially valuable for female entrepreneurs balancing work and family responsibilities. Tools like video conferencing also support remote teams.

3. Levels the playing field – Technology helps women access information, financing, networks and customers. Online platforms allow them to promote their business widely. Tools like Shopify, QuickBooks and Canva create an affordable infrastructure.

4. Drives efficiency – Apps, software, CRM platforms and other tech tools save time on mundane tasks and keep businesses running smoothly. Automation frees up time for strategy and creativity.

5. Enables community – Through online networks and social media groups, women entrepreneurs can find mentors, collaborate with peers and access emotional support. Facebook groups and networking platforms like Elpha help them feel less isolated.

Technology will continue opening doors for the next generation of women in business. With the right tools, knowledge and community, female entrepreneurs are empowered to turn their dreams into reality. The future looks bright for women who leverage technology strategically in their ventures.

The Crucial Role of Data Quality in Data Analysis

Introduction:

Data analysis is a powerful tool that can unlock valuable insights and drive informed decision-making. However, the success of any analysis hinges on one crucial factor: data quality. In the words of an unknown sage, “Remember, your analysis is only as good as the data you work with.” This statement resonates strongly with data analysts who understand the profound impact of data quality on the accuracy and reliability of their findings. In this blog post, we delve into the importance of data quality and why it should be a top priority for every data analyst.

Why Data Quality Matters:

Data quality refers to the accuracy, completeness, consistency, and relevancy of data.

Here’s why it matters:

  1. Reliable Insights: High-quality data ensures the reliability of the insights derived from analysis. Flawed or incomplete data can lead to erroneous conclusions and misguided decisions. Data analysts must strive for data that is trustworthy and representative of the real world.
  2. Enhanced Decision-Making: Decision-makers rely on accurate and reliable information to make strategic choices. Data of poor quality can introduce biases, distortions, and incorrect assumptions, leading to suboptimal decisions. Data analysts play a crucial role in ensuring data quality to provide decision-makers with a solid foundation for their choices.
  3. Efficient Operations: Poor data quality can have cascading effects on business operations. It can result in wasted time, resources, and effort spent on analyzing and acting upon incorrect or irrelevant data. Data analysts can mitigate these risks by proactively addressing data quality issues and establishing robust data governance practices.

Ensuring Data Quality:

To prioritize data quality, data analysts should implement the following practices:

  1. Data Profiling: Conduct a thorough assessment of data quality by analyzing its structure, integrity, and consistency. Identify anomalies, errors, and outliers that may impact analysis.
  2. Data Cleansing: Employ data cleansing techniques to rectify inaccuracies, inconsistencies, and missing values. Remove duplicates, address outliers, and handle missing data appropriately to ensure a clean and reliable dataset.
  3. Validation and Verification: Validate the accuracy and completeness of data through various validation techniques. Cross-reference data against external sources, perform integrity checks, and verify data against known benchmarks.
  4. Documentation and Metadata: Maintain comprehensive documentation of data sources, transformations, and cleaning procedures. Capture metadata, such as data lineage, to provide transparency and enable reproducibility of analysis.
  5. Data Governance: Establish data governance frameworks and policies to ensure ongoing data quality. Implement data quality monitoring mechanisms, define data quality standards, and regularly assess and address data quality issues.

Conclusion:

Data quality is the bedrock of reliable data analysis. By prioritizing data quality, data analysts contribute to the integrity and trustworthiness of their analysis outcomes. As the custodians of data, it is their responsibility to ensure data accuracy, completeness, consistency, and relevancy.

By following best practices, employing data cleansing techniques, and implementing robust data governance, data analysts can empower decision-makers with accurate insights and drive meaningful impact through their work.

The Importance of Consistency and Signifiers in UI Design

User interface design is an integral part of any product development process. It involves creating an interface that users can interact with seamlessly, efficiently, and enjoyably. Two essential principles in UI design are consistency and signifiers.

Consistency refers to the uniformity of the interface design across different pages, screens, and interactions. It makes it easy for users to navigate and understand the product. When a product has a consistent design, users can quickly learn how to perform different actions and predict what will happen when they click on different buttons.

On the other hand, signifiers refer to the visual cues that help users understand how to interact with the product. They include buttons, icons, color, and typography. Signifiers should be clear and easy to understand to avoid confusion and frustration for users.

Consistency and signifiers are crucial in UI design because they improve the user experience, reduce errors, and increase user engagement. When a product is consistent, users are more likely to trust it and feel confident using it. Signifiers help users understand the product’s functionality and how to navigate it, reducing the learning curve.

In conclusion, consistency and signifiers are essential principles in UI design. They create a seamless user experience and help users navigate and understand the product. As a UI designer, it’s essential to keep these principles in mind when designing interfaces to ensure the best possible user experience.

User Interface Design in 3 Minutes

What is UI?

The user interface (UI) acts as the medium of interaction between a user and a device or technology. It comprises of a set of visual components and controls such as menus, buttons, and icons that enable users to control and interact with the system. UI can either be graphical, as seen on a smartphone or computer, or command-line based as found on a computer’s command-line interface.

An effective user interface should possess attributes such as ease of use, visual appeal, and should provide users with clear and consistent feedback. It should also be designed in such a way that it is intuitive and efficient, making it easy for users to perform the necessary tasks with ease.

In designing a user interface, the layout, visual elements, interactions, and feedback are taken into consideration to create a satisfying and user-friendly experience with the product. The process is iterative, requiring continuous testing and improvement, as designers work in tandem with developers and stakeholders.

What is the difference between UX and UI?

UX (User Experience) and UI (User Interface) are two closely related yet distinct fields in design. UX design focuses on the overall feel and flow of a product, from research and prototyping to testing and iteration. It aims to understand the user needs, motivations, and behaviors and create a product that meets their goals efficiently and effectively. UX design includes aspects such as information architecture, wireframing, and usability testing.

UI design, on the other hand, focuses on the look and feel of a product. It involves designing visual elements such as colors, typography, and iconography, as well as the layout and structure of a product’s interface.

Who is a UI designer?

A UI (User Interface) designer is a professional responsible for the design of the graphical interface of a product, such as a website or application. They are responsible for creating the look and feel of the product, including the layout, typography, color palette, and visual elements such as buttons and icons.

A UI designer works closely with UX designers and developers to ensure that the interface is aesthetically pleasing, user-friendly, and consistent with the overall design style of the product. They may also be involved in creating and testing prototypes, as well as updating and maintaining the visual design as the product evolves.

The role of a UI designer requires a strong understanding of visual design principles, as well as the ability to create wireframes, mockups, and prototypes using design software. Good communication and collaboration skills are also important, as the UI designer must work closely with other members of the design and development teams.

Key Principles of Effective UI Design: Affordance and Feedback

Attention UI designers! When creating digital products, it’s important to keep in mind two crucial design principles: affordance and feedback.

Affordance refers to the perceived functionality of an object based on its design. For example, a button with a raised appearance and a shadow effect is perceived as something that can be clicked. On the other hand, a flat image without any raised appearance may not be perceived as clickable, and therefore not an effective affordance.

Feedback is the process of giving users clear and immediate responses to their actions within a digital product. This can come in the form of an animation, sound, or visual cue. Providing feedback lets users know that their actions have been registered and encourages continued engagement.
